People can only see the outside of you. They cannot see what is going on inside your head.
I am very good at hiding my unusual sensory reactions, my near-panic state in some social situations, etc. And a high IQ will cover up lots of other problems (e.g. you might have executive function problems, but be so intelligent that you can afford to leave most tasks to the last minute, and still get them done well - but you would have performed even better without the executive function problems ... you might be getting a respectable B+ when you should be achieving an excellent A+).
If you get really good at hiding your reactions so that no one else notices them, then they will just assume that you are like them.
